Funcții PHP MYSQL

P

Pe această pagină veți găsi toate metodele disponibile în PHP pentru a interacționa cu baza de date precum MySQL.

Pentru a instala MySQLi în PHP, faceți clic pe acest link http://php.net/manual/en/mysqli.installation.php

Pentru configurațiile de rulare ale MySQLi, faceți clic pe acest link  http://php.net/manual/en/mysqli.configuration.php

Extensia MySQLi vine cu PHP v5.0

FuncţieDescriere
afectad_rânduri()Returnează numărul de rânduri afectate în operația anterioară MySQL
autocommit()Activați sau dezactivați modificarea automată a bazei de date
begin_transaction()Începe o tranzacție
schimbă utilizatorul()Schimbați utilizatorul conexiunii la baza de date specificată
nume_set_caractere()Returnează setul de caractere implicit pentru conexiunea la baza de date
închise()Închideți o conexiune la baza de date deschisă anterior
commit()Angajați tranzacția curentă
conectați ()Deschideți o nouă conexiune la serverul MySQL
connect_errno()Returnează codul de eroare de la ultima eroare de conexiune
connect_error()Returnează descrierea erorii de la ultima eroare de conexiune
data_seek()Ajustați indicatorul de rezultat la un rând arbitrar din setul de rezultate
depanare()Efectuați operațiuni de depanare
dump_debug_info()Turnați informațiile de depanare în jurnal
greșit()Returnează ultimul cod de eroare pentru cel mai recent apel de funcție
eroare()Returnează ultima descriere a erorii pentru cel mai recent apel de funcție
lista_eroare()Returnează o listă de erori pentru cel mai recent apel de funcție
aduce_toate()Preluați toate rândurile rezultate ca o matrice asociativă, o matrice numerică sau ambele
fetch_array()Preluați un rând de rezultat ca asociativ, o matrice numerică sau ambele
fetch_assoc()Preluați un rând de rezultat ca o matrice asociativă
fetch_field()Returnează următorul câmp din setul de rezultate, ca obiect
fetch_field_direct()Returnează metadate pentru un singur câmp din setul de rezultate, ca obiect
fetch_fields()Returnează o matrice de obiecte care reprezintă câmpurile dintr-un set de rezultate
fetch_lengths()Returnează lungimile coloanelor rândului curent din setul de rezultate
fetch_object()Returnează rândul curent al unui set de rezultate, ca obiect
fetch_row()Preluați un rând dintr-un set de rezultate și obțineți-l ca o matrice enumerată
field_count()Returnează numărul de coloane pentru cea mai recentă interogare
field_seek()Setați cursorul câmpului la decalajul câmpului dat
get_charset()Returnează un obiect set de caractere
get_client_info()Returnează versiunea bibliotecii client MySQL
get_client_stats()Returnează statistici despre client per proces
get_client_version()Returnează versiunea bibliotecii client MySQL ca număr întreg
get_connection_stats()Returnează statistici despre conexiunea client
get_host_info()Returnează numele de gazdă a serverului MySQL și tipul de conexiune
get_proto_info()Returnează versiunea protocolului MySQL
get_server_info()Returnează versiunea serverului MySQL
get_server_version()Returnează versiunea serverului MySQL ca număr întreg
info ()Returnează informații despre ultima interogare executată
init ()Inițializați MySQLi și obțineți o resursă pentru utilizare cu real_connect()
insert_id()Returnează id-ul generat automat de la ultima interogare
ucide()Cereți serverului să oprească un fir MySQL
mai multe rezultate()Verificați dacă există mai multe rezultate dintr-o interogare multiplă
multi_query()Efectuați una sau mai multe interogări în baza de date
următorul_rezultat()Pregătiți următorul set de rezultate din multi_query()
Opțiuni()Setați opțiuni suplimentare de conectare și afectați comportamentul unei conexiuni
ping()Dați ping la o conexiune la server sau încercați să vă reconectați dacă conexiunea sa întrerupt
sondaj()Conexiuni la sondaje
a pregati()Pregătiți o instrucțiune SQL pentru execuție
interogare ()Efectuați o interogare împotriva unei baze de date
real_connect()Deschideți o nouă conexiune la serverul MySQL
real_escape_string()Escape caractere speciale dintr-un șir pentru utilizare într-o instrucțiune SQL
interogare_reala()Executați o singură interogare SQL
reap_async_query()Returnează rezultatul unei interogări SQL asincrone
reîmprospăta()Reîmprospătați/spăiți tabelele sau cache-urile sau resetați informațiile serverului de replicare
rollback()Derulați înapoi tranzacția curentă pentru baza de date
select_db()Selectați baza de date implicită pentru interogările bazei de date
set_charset()Setați setul de caractere implicit pentru client
set_local_infile_default()Dezactivează handlerul definit de utilizator pentru comanda de încărcare a fișierului local
set_local_infile_handler()Setați funcția de apel invers pentru comanda LOAD DATA LOCAL INFILE
sqlstate()Returnează codul de eroare SQLSTATE pentru eroare
ssl_set()Folosit pentru a stabili conexiuni securizate folosind SSL
stat ()Returnează starea curentă a sistemului
stmt_init()Inițializați o instrucțiune și obțineți un obiect pentru utilizare cu stmt_prepare()
store_result()Transferați un set de rezultate din ultima interogare
thread_id()Returnează ID-ul firului pentru conexiunea curentă
fir de siguranta()Returnează dacă biblioteca client este compilată ca fire-safe
use_result()Inițiază preluarea unui set de rezultate din ultima interogare executată
warning_count()Returnează numărul de avertismente de la ultima interogare din conexiune
Funcții MySQL în PHP

Adaugă comentariu

Rețeaua de tutori

Învață PHP de la A la Z